0

Eslint 加载,但不修复“问题 js”... 文件 eslint.config.json

    {
  "ecmaFeatures": {
    "jsx": true
  },
  "env": {
    "browser": true,
    "node": true,
    "jquery": true
  },
  "rules": {
    "quotes": 0,
    "no-trailing-space": 0,
    "eol-last": 0,
    "no-unused-vars":0,
    "no-underscore-dangle":0,
    "no-alert": 0,
    "no-lone-blocks": 0
  },
  "globals": {
    jQuery: true,
    $ : true
  }
}

在 JS 文件中,我可以使用全局变量... Lint 不检查 JS。

4

2 回答 2

1

如果您使用较新的版本,则默认情况下不会启用 1.0.0 任何规则。由于您上面的配置仅显示禁用规则,这意味着 eslint 在没有启用规则的情况下运行,因此不会发现任何错误。您可能想要做的是将以下行添加到您的配置中:

{
  "extends": "eslint:recommended"
}

这将启用此页面上标记为推荐的所有规则。或者你也可以扩展现有的配置,你可以通过搜索在 NPM 上找到eslint-config-

于 2015-11-16T02:07:32.520 回答
0

我有同样的问题。在 .eslintrc 中添加以下行有助于:

"extends": ["eslint:recommended", "plugin:react/recommended"]

注意:扩展选项可能已经存在,但没有插件选项。

于 2016-05-11T09:21:30.213 回答